Abstract

For the first time novel water-based graphene flake solution was deposited on substrates with an interdigital ITO/gold-electrode design. The electrical properties before and after thermal annealing at 120 °C were investigated and the deposition method was evaluated with different dilution concentrations. The graphene thin film was investigated with AFM measurements. The substrates and the measurement setup allowed the characterization of the deposited graphene solution. Further examination of contact resistance and layer deposition methods is needed.
